Amazon Kindle Paperwhite Waterproof

The Amazon Kindle Paperwhite Waterproof is an e-reader designed for reading convenience both indoors and outdoors. It features a high-resolution display with built-in adjustable lighting, waterproof capabilities (IPX8 rated), and a long-lasting battery. The device aims to provide a seamless reading experience, whether at the beach, by the pool, or in the bath, making it ideal for avid readers who want durability along with comfort.
Key Features
- High-resolution 300 ppi display for crisp text and images
- Built-in adjustable warm light for comfortable reading at any time of day
- Waterproof design (IPX8 rated) allowing immersion in water up to 2 meters for 60 minutes
- Long-lasting battery life lasting weeks on a single charge
- 8 GB or 32 GB storage options for thousands of ebooks
- Built-in front light with adjustable brightness and warmth
- Supports Wi-Fi for easy wireless downloads and synchronization
- Glare-free screen suitable for outdoor reading
Pros
- Waterproof feature enhances durability for outdoor use
- High-resolution display provides clear, sharp text
- Adjustable warm light improves readability in various lighting conditions
- Long battery life reduces frequent charging needs
- Robust build quality with premium materials
Cons
- Higher price point compared to basic e-readers
- Limited to Amazon's ecosystem which may restrict content flexibility
- No color display, primarily suited for monochrome text and images
- Some users may find the device slightly bulky compared to smaller e-readers
